Hydraulic Technician

 

Job Description

 

Dieffenbacher is an international company that develops and manufactures hydraulic presses and complete production systems for the wood panel and automotive industries. With our commitment to innovation, we are a partner of choice for our customers, in our view, innovation is the foundation for growth.

 

Dieffenbacher North America is looking for a Hydraulic Technician to work as part of the team in our facility in Windsor, Ontario.

As experience is gained on the Dieffenbacher systems, this position’s duties will evolve to include service trips to customer sites for set-up, repairing and maintaining Dieffenbacher machinery.

 

Requirements.

  • Recent graduate of a Community College or University

 

  • Creative problem solving skills
  • Ability to work in a challenging and changing environment
  • Good understanding of hydraulic, pneumatic, mechanical, and electric systems
  • Able to use common shop tools for making repairs and fabricating parts
  • Enjoy working in a team
  • Able to work under pressure and be flexible
  • Readiness for travel activity
  • Able to read, write, and speak English fluently
  • Foreign language skills are an advantage
  • Knowledge of controls and PLCs would be an asset

 

 

The successful candidate will be trained to become proficient at the following Responsibilities:

 

  • Reading and interpreting job specifications, blueprints, engineering or design drawings and schematics.
  • Performing work based on drawings, sketches, codes and company procedures.
  • Maintaining and using hand and power tools.
  • Performing bench work including assembly and disassembly, modification, cleaning, measuring, inspection and testing of hydraulic and pneumatic equipment.
  • Inspecting and examining hydraulic components and parts including cylinders and pistons for wear, and defects.
  • Installing, testing, repairing or rebuilding hydraulic/pneumatic equipment to job specifications.
  • Identifying and applying lubricants including oils, greases, graphite; installing lubrication equipment and components.
  • Writing quality/technical reports and maintaining repair records.
